Bernie Sanders and a New York Times reporter engaged in a frosty back-and-forth Monday, after she asked him whether it’s “sexist” of him not to concede to Hillary Clinton at this point in the race.
The exchange took place at a press conference in Emeryville, California, between Sanders and the NYT’s Yamiche Alcindor. Excruciatingly awkward video from Politico shows that Sanders and Alcindor first clashed over whether it was her turn to ask a question:
“Excuse me,” he says five times, as she tries to speak.
“I’m asking a question,” she shoots back.
